1. Beets: The Nitric Oxide Powerhouse 1. Beets: The Nitric Oxide Powerhouse (image credits: unsplash) Beets have become a star in blood pressure research, thanks to their high nitrate content. When consumed, dietary nitrates in beets are converted into nitric oxide, a compound that relaxes and widens blood vessels, making it easier for blood to flow. A 2024 meta-analysis published in the journal Hypertension found that daily beetroot juice consumption could lower systolic blood pressure by an average of 4.7 mmHg in adults with hypertension. The Surprising Power of Za’atar The Surprising Power of Za’atar (image credits: wikimedia) Za’atar, a vibrant Middle Eastern spice blend, is making its way into kitchens around the globe—and for good reason. This aromatic mix typically includes thyme, sumac, sesame seeds, and salt. When sprinkled onto roasted vegetables, flatbreads, or even popcorn, it gives an earthy, tangy burst of flavor that’s both bold and comforting. According to a 2024 global flavor trend report, za’atar has seen a 35% increase in use in Western recipes over the past two years, reflecting its rising popularity.
